British stocks follow BP down

BRITISH stocks including BP Plc fell after Europe’s largest oil producer reported a drop in first-quarter profit.

The FTSE 100 Index slipped 12.1, or 0.2%, to 6,086.6, even as more stocks rose than fell.

The FTSE All-Share Index lost 0.1% to 3106.03.

Tesco declined as profit growth slowed for Britain’s largest supermarket.
